I Was Offered N5bn Bribe To Impeach Fubara – Former Majority Leader

The Chief of Staff to the suspended Governor of Rivers State, Edison Ehie, has revealed that he was offered N5 billion as bribe to support the impeachment of his principal while serving as Majority Leader of the Rivers State House of Assembly.

Ehie said this while speaking as guest on Channels Television on Sunday, stressing that he has the evidence on his phone.

According to him, the offer was made while he was serving as the majority leader of the Rivers State House of Assembly.

The Chief of Staff also denied claims that he orchestrated the October 30, 2023, bombing of the Rivers Assembly complex on Fubara’s orders.

Recall that former Head of Service in the state, George Nwaeke, had during a press conference last Friday accused him of being a key actor in the bombing that took place on the night of October 29, 2023.

Speaking further, Ehie said Governor Siminalayi Fubara chose the path of conflict resolution in handling political disputes.

“I can also open my phone to show you, in the beginning of October 2023, they approached me with a bribe of N5 billion. It is here in my phone,

“It was for impeachment. It’s here. I have it and I have printed it and distributed it, in case, in their evil imagination, they decide to attack me. I already have a son and a brother,” he said.

In dismissing his being liked to the Assembly Complex bombing, Ehie said it is politically motivated,

He said, “It is very important to clarify that I had no hand and was not part of the burning down of the Rivers State House of Assembly.

“Like everyone else, I woke up in the early hours of 30th of October 2023 to hear of the burning down of the Rivers State House of Assembly.”

He added that he had instructed his lawyers to file a lawsuit against Nwaeke for criminal libel.

“I will not join issues completely with Mr. George Nwaeke because I have already instructed my lawyers to file an issue of criminal libel against him, and I hope he is very prepared to substantiate his claims and his allegations,” Ehie said.
